Transaction 086975f89da662ff702873c8cdafd99a54f4021ce1759da6427e0a30fe0546e1

1 Input
2 Outputs
  • 086975f89da662ff702873c8cdafd99a54f4021ce1759da6427e0a30fe0546e1:0
  • value  2871359
    address  193ttSPFM9hw8YhKQM3dZ3VnDVf5yqMYU6
  • 086975f89da662ff702873c8cdafd99a54f4021ce1759da6427e0a30fe0546e1:1
  • value  6695523
    address  33barVCUpqihyoxZWVoFRpZ1biTTdB48GP